Why Consider Replacing Your Heat Pump Now?

Aging heat pumps can become less efficient over time, working harder to maintain desired temperatures and consuming more energy. Several factors can indicate that replacing your heat pump is a smart investment:

  1. Age: Most heat pumps have a lifespan of 10–15 years. If your system is approaching or exceeding this age, its efficiency may be significantly reduced, and the risk of costly breakdowns increases.
  2. Frequent Repairs: Needing multiple Heat Pump Repair calls each year is a clear sign your system is nearing the end of its service life. Repair costs can accumulate quickly, potentially outweighing the cost of a new, more reliable unit.
  3. Decreased Performance: If your heat pump no longer heats or cools your home evenly, struggles to reach set temperatures, or runs constantly, it's likely losing capacity.
  4. Rising Energy Bills: A noticeable increase in your electricity bills without a change in usage patterns can point to an inefficient heat pump working overtime to compensate for wear and tear.
  5. Unusual Noises: Grinding, banging, or persistent rattling sounds from your heat pump can indicate serious internal issues that may be expensive to repair and signal impending failure.

Replacing an outdated system proactively can save you from unexpected breakdowns during extreme weather and provide peace of mind with reliable performance.

The Benefits of a New Heat Pump

Investing in a new heat pump offers substantial advantages for Oconomowoc homeowners:

  1. Enhanced Energy Efficiency: Modern heat pumps boast higher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io (SEER) for cooling and Heating Seasonal Performance Factor (HSPF) for heating. Higher ratings mean the system uses less energy to provide the same amount of heating or cooling, directly translating to lower utility bills.
  2. Improved Comfort: New systems provide more consistent temperatures throughout your home, eliminating hot and cold spots. Variable-speed or multi-stage models offer quieter operation and more precise temperature control.
  3. Dual Functionality: Heat pumps provide both efficient heating and cooling in a single system, simplifying your home's climate control and potentially replacing both an older furnace and air conditioner.
  4. Environmental Impact: By using electricity to move heat rather than generate it from fossil fuels, heat pumps can significantly reduce your home's carbon footprint.
  5. Increased Home Value: An updated, energy-efficient HVAC system is an attractive feature for potential buyers should you decide to sell your home.

Our Heat Pump Replacement Process

Replacing a heat pump is a significant home improvement, and our process is designed to make it as smooth and straightforward as possible for Oconomowoc residents.

  • Initial Consultation & Home Assessment: Our experienced technicians will visit your Oconomowoc home to assess your current heating and cooling needs. This involves evaluating the size of your home, insulation levels, existing ductwork condition, and your comfort preferences. A proper load calculation (Manual J) is crucial to determine the correctly sized system for optimal performance and efficiency.
  • System Selection & Recommendation: Based on the assessment, we'll recommend suitable heat pump systems that meet your home's requirements and your budget. We explain the differences in efficiency ratings (SEER, HSPF), features, and potential long-term savings of various models, including options like air source heat pumps commonly used in this region.
  • Professional Installation: Our certified and skilled technicians handle the complete installation process. This includes carefully disconnecting and removing your old heat pump system, preparing the site, installing the new indoor and outdoor units, making necessary electrical and refrigerant connections, and ensuring everything is installed according to manufacturer specifications and local codes. We take care to protect your home during the process and ensure the safe and proper disposal of your old equipment.
  • System Testing & Customer Walkthrough: Once the installation is complete, we thoroughly test the new heat pump to ensure it's operating correctly in both heating and cooling modes. We verify airflow, temperature output, and overall system performance. We then walk you through the new system, explaining its operation, programmable thermostat features, and basic maintenance requirements. We answer any questions you may have.

Choosing the Right Heat Pump for Your Oconomowoc Home

Selecting the appropriate heat pump involves considering factors specific to your home and the local climate. Key specifications like S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) for cooling and HSPF (Heating Seasonal Performance Factor) for heating are important. Given Wisconsin's colder winters, a higher HSPF rating is particularly valuable for efficient heating performance in lower temperatures. Our experts guide you through selecting a system that balances upfront cost with long-term energy savings and provides reliable comfort throughout the year.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does heat pump replacement take? The duration of a heat pump replacement depends on the complexity of the job, including removing the old system and installing the new one. Most standard residential heat pump replacements can be completed within one to two days.

Do heat pumps work well in Wisconsin winters? Modern cold-climate heat pumps are specifically designed to provide effective heating even when outdoor temperatures drop significantly below freezing. While supplemental heating (often built into the system or provided by a backup furnace) may be needed on the coldest days, a properly sized and installed heat pump can be a primary heat source for most of the Wisconsin heating season, offering significant energy savings compared to electric resistance heat.

What kind of warranty is included with a new heat pump? New heat pumps typically come with a manufacturer's warranty covering parts for a specific period, often 10 years with registration. We also offer a labor warranty for the installation work we perform, providing comprehensive coverage.

Is heat pump replacement covered by homeowners insurance? Generally, homeowners insurance does not cover the replacement of an HVAC system due to normal wear and tear, age, or mechanical breakdown. Coverage is typically limited to damage caused by specific covered perils, such as fire, lightning, or certain types of water damage. It's always best to check your specific policy or contact your insurance provider for details.

Should I also consider replacing my ductwork? During the assessment, we can inspect your existing ductwork. Leaky or improperly sized ducts can reduce the efficiency and performance of a new heat pump.
